Patent number: 9965766Abstract: The collection of social data from social networking services for market research purposes is improved by automating the formulation of a final query rule sets by analyzing relevant keywords captured using a seed query rule set based on a user input. Relevant keywords from social mentions based on a seed query rule set for a brand name and/or product can be extracted to form at least parts of a final query rule set. The relevant keywords can then be disambiguated by using a searchable reference to resolve ambiguities. Any generalities in the relevant keywords can also be resolved by analyzing the co-occurrence of the relevant keywords with relevant keywords from another brand and/or product. The relevant keywords having been disambiguated and having generalities resolved therein, may be used to automatically generate a final query rule set for providing relevant search results based on the user input.Type: GrantFiled: January 6, 2015Date of Patent: May 8, 2018Assignee: Adobe Systems IncorporatedInventors: Balaji Vasan Srinivasan, Nikhil Mohan Nainani, Tanya Goyal, Kartik Sreenivasan, Shriram Revankar, David Nicholas Bieselin

Patent number: 9852239Abstract: A method and apparatus for prediction of community reaction to a post for an online social community is disclosed. The method comprises receiving a proposed post as input to a generated prediction model prior to the proposed post being posted to an online social community; predicting a community reaction to the proposed post using the prediction model; and displaying the predication, wherein the prediction comprises a sentiment score and at least one of a number of responses, a number of responders to the post, a longevity of the post, or a half-life of the post.Type: GrantFiled: September 24, 2012Date of Patent: December 26, 2017Assignee: ADOBE SYSTEMS INCORPORATEDInventors: Anandhavelu Natarajan, Balaji Vasan Srinivasan, Vineet Gupta, Anand Ganesan, Anuj Jain, Shriram Revankar, Japnik Singh, Bharat Polineni

Patent number: 9607273Abstract: Computer-implemented methods and systems are disclosed for making a recommending providing a post on a social media forum. One exemplary embodiment involves utilizing machine-learning techniques to produce a model capable of determining optimal post recommendations from various posting factors. The model may be produced from historical post information regarding various posts made by, for instance, marketers on a social media forum and corresponding community interest responses to the posts made by the community of users associated with the social media forum. The model may be provided to a recommendation engine.Type: GrantFiled: January 8, 2014Date of Patent: March 28, 2017Assignee: Adobe Systems IncorporatedInventors: Balaji Vasan Srinivasan, Anandhavelu N, Ritwik Sinha, Shriram Revankar

Patent number: 8065297Abstract: One exemplary method embodiment, pre-processes customer requests that are maintained in a dataset to create a matrix between products and the customer requests. Each of the customer requests comprises at least a customer identification, a textual request, and a product identification related to the textual request. After such pre-processing of the dataset, the method can respond to queries of the dataset using the matrix.Type: GrantFiled: June 9, 2008Date of Patent: November 22, 2011Assignee: Xerox CorporationInventors: Wei Peng, Tong Sun, Shriram Revankar

Publication number: 20080065455Abstract: A system and method of modeling and evaluating workflows that provides workflow auto generation and Hierarchical Dependence Graphs for workflows. Modeling and evaluation of workflows is accomplished by accessing a knowledge database containing service descriptions, generating valid workflows models, simulating workflow and obtaining customer requirements through a Graphical User Interface. This system and method generate and display workflows that satisfy a users requirements. In addition, Hierarchical Dependence Graphs provide abstract views that provide additional analysis and control of workflow.Type: ApplicationFiled: November 14, 2007Publication date: March 13, 2008Applicant: Xerox CorporationInventors: Tong Sun, John Walker, Shriram Revankar, Narasimha Gottumukkala

Publication number: 20070094211Abstract: A system and method of automatically generating workflows. Generating the workflows is accomplished by obtaining customer requirements, providing a knowledge base including at least one service description and selecting at least one combination of service descriptions from the at least one service description based on satisfaction of the customer requirements and satisfaction of determination of connectivity between service descriptions for each combination of the at least one combination. At least one valid workflow model is generated by inference, each workflow model including a combination of the at least one combination.Type: ApplicationFiled: August 7, 2006Publication date: April 26, 2007Inventors: Tong Sun, John Walker, Shriram Revankar, Narasimha Gottumukkala

Patent number: 6240205Abstract: A method and apparatus for segmenting image data into windows and for classifying the windows as typical image types includes making two passes through the image data. The method includes a step of making a first pass through the image data to identify windows and to record the beginning points and image types of each of the windows, and a step of making a second pass through the image data to label each of the pixels as a particular image type. The invention also includes a macro-detection method and apparatus for separating a scanline of image data into edges and image runs and for classifying each of the edges and image runs as standard image types. In the macro-detection method, image runs and edges are classified based on micro-detection results and based on image types of adjacent image runs.Type: GrantFiled: June 18, 1998Date of Patent: May 29, 2001Assignee: Xerox CorporationInventors: Zhigang Fan, Kathy Ryall, Jeng-Nan Shiau, Shriram Revankar
